HTML 5 & php - adresse IP ?

Fermé
Arno59 Messages postés 4600 Date d'inscription jeudi 23 octobre 2003 Statut Contributeur Dernière intervention 18 avril 2023 - 13 juil. 2012 à 18:15
Arno59 Messages postés 4600 Date d'inscription jeudi 23 octobre 2003 Statut Contributeur Dernière intervention 18 avril 2023 - 7 août 2012 à 13:58
Bonjour,

Je souhaiterais ajouter une ligne dans mes pages web pour afficher les adresses IP de mes visiteurs.

Quelles sont les commandes en PHP ou HTML 5 pour obtenir et afficher adresse IP ?

D'avance merci.

4 réponses

tryan44 Messages postés 1288 Date d'inscription mardi 24 janvier 2012 Statut Membre Dernière intervention 26 octobre 2014 219
Modifié par tryan44 le 13/07/2012 à 21:47
<?php 
if(!empty($_SERVER["REMOTE_ADDR"])){ 
 echo 'Votre ip est : '.$_SERVER["REMOTE_ADDR"].''; 
} 
else{ 
 echo 'Ip indéterminé!'; 
} 
?>

Une question stupide engendre une réponse stupide!
Une question mal formulé engendre une réponse aléatoire!
1
indeterminée
0
tryan44 Messages postés 1288 Date d'inscription mardi 24 janvier 2012 Statut Membre Dernière intervention 26 octobre 2014 219
14 juil. 2012 à 09:38
Votre hébergeur accepte bien le PHP?
0
Arno59 Messages postés 4600 Date d'inscription jeudi 23 octobre 2003 Statut Contributeur Dernière intervention 18 avril 2023 484
7 août 2012 à 13:57
Aucune indication, comment savoir que PHP est compatible avec l'opérateur Télécom ?
0
Essaie ca et dit moi si ca marche:
 Your ip address is:   
 <select name="IP" id="IP">   
  <?php   
  $IP=$_SERVER['REMOTE_ADDR'];   
  echo "<option>".$IP."</option>";        
  ?>   
 </select>   


:)
0
Navid_92 Messages postés 711 Date d'inscription dimanche 7 décembre 2008 Statut Membre Dernière intervention 12 février 2015 87
13 juil. 2012 à 23:22
<?php 
if isset($_SERVER['REMOTE_ADDR']):
$ip = $_SERVER['REMOTE_ADDR'];
else:
$ip = 'indéterminée.';
endif;
?>

<span>Votre ip est <?php echo $ip; ?></span>
0
Arno59 Messages postés 4600 Date d'inscription jeudi 23 octobre 2003 Statut Contributeur Dernière intervention 18 avril 2023 484
7 août 2012 à 13:58
Ce script est à mettre dans la partie <body> ?
0